Q: Purchased songs not showing on iPhone

I have past purchases that are not visible on my iPhone.

I have followed the steps on this page: Download your past purchases - Apple Support. I have restarted phone.

 

If I go to the album in question in iTunes Store, Kidz Bop Party Hits (don't judge), it shows as purchased, with no option to download ) i.e. no cloud/arrow icon.

If I go into my phone Store>Other>Music>Purchased>NotOnThisiPhone, the artist/album is not there. There are other artists that have disappeared from my phone and its playlists as well, but this is the most obvious and easiest to track down.

 

A little help please?

    Hello ainuke,

     

    I understand wanting to listen to the whole album that you purchased. I would suggest transferring your purchases to a computer in iTunes and then syncing your Music back to your iPhone.

     

    This article has the steps to transfer your purchases to iTunes on your computer: 

     

    Redownload or transfer your iTunes Store purchases from an iPhone, iPad, or iPod to a computer

     

    Once the purchases have been transferred then sync the music to your iPhone using the steps in this article:

     

    Sync your i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ch with iTunes on your computer using USB
